Abstract

We report the result of a search for charginos and neutralinos, in e(+)e(-) collisions at 189 GeV centre-of-mass energy at LEP, No evidence for such particles is found in a data sample of 176 pb(-1). Improved upper limits for these particles are set on the production cross sections. New exclusion contours in the parameter space of the Minimal Supersymmetric Standard Model are derived, as well as new lower limits on the masses of these supersymmetric particles. Under the assumptions of common gaugino and scalar masses at the GUT scale, we set an absolute lower limit on the mass of the lightest neutralino of 32.5 GeV, and a limit on the mass of the lightest chargino of 67.7 GeV for M-2
